Dude my car was exactly the same. I was running a test pipe to a 2.25 " midpipe to a small turndown and the combination of it all just made the turbo spool insanely loud. When I drove past you making 5+ lbs. of boost it would no joke hurt your ears. Everyone knew my car for the really loud turbo. It was ok for me cause inside the car the turbo wouldn't hurt your ears. For other cars though...haha. Then I had to get a cat so I could get my car inspected so I went ahead and got a High-flow cat, full 3" exhaust all the way back... no muffler or resonator. The spool is much quiter than what it was, but soon I will get a test pipe in again. I think that the noise wasn't just the turbo. I think that the air rushing through the intake might have combined with the whistle of the turbo to make just a super high pitched loud whistle.
